Fiber Optic Cable Parallel Box

A Fiber Optic Cable Parallel Box is a compact enclosure used to organize, protect, and distribute multiple fiber optic connections in parallel, supporting splicing, termination, and high-density cabling management.

Overview

A fiber optic parallel box serves as a centralized point for managing multiple fiber optic cables, allowing for organized routing, protection, and distribution of optical signals. These boxes are commonly used in FTTH (Fiber-to-the-Home), FTTB (Fiber-to-the-Building), small office networks, and data centers. They provide a secure environment for both splicing and termination, reducing the risk of cable damage and ensuring reliable connectivity .

Key Functions

  • Cable Termination: Supports termination of single-mode or multimode fibers using adapters such as SC, LC, FC, or ST .
  • Splice Protection: Houses fusion or mechanical splices safely, preventing physical damage and environmental exposure .
  • Parallel Distribution: Enables multiple fibers to be routed in parallel, simplifying network expansion and maintenance.
  • High-Density Management: In data centers, parallel boxes can integrate with Fiber Shuffle solutions, which remap fiber connections for compact, organized, and scalable cabling .

Types and Form Factors

  • Wall-Mount Boxes: Compact enclosures suitable for residential or office installations, often supporting 4–48 ports .
  • Rack-Mount or 19-Inch Splice Boxes: Standardized for integration into network racks, ideal for larger deployments .
  • Dome or Vertical Closures: Used in outdoor or aerial applications, providing environmental protection and space-efficient installation .
  • Shuffle Boxes: Specialized modular boxes that reorganize fiber paths for high-density environments, improving serviceability and airflow in data centers .

Installation and Use

Fiber optic parallel boxes are designed for easy installation and maintenance. They can be wall-mounted, desktop-mounted, or integrated into racks. Pre-configured boxes often support plug-and-play deployment, reducing setup time and minimizing errors in fiber mapping . They are particularly useful in environments where port-to-port correspondence and high fiber counts require precise organization.

Applications

  • Residential Broadband Networks: Distributing fiber to multiple homes efficiently.
  • Office and Industrial Networks: Centralized fiber management for internal networks.
  • Data Centers: High-density fiber management with shuffle boxes for optimized cabling and airflow.
  • FTTH/FTTB Deployments: Protecting and organizing fibers in distribution hubs or terminal points . In summary, a Fiber Optic Cable Parallel Box is an essential component for structured fiber optic networks, providing protection, organization, and scalability for multiple fiber connections while supporting both splicing and termination in a compact, serviceable form factor.
